United edge Liverpool 3-2 to book Champions League spot

United edge Liverpool 3-2 to book Champions League spot

By Priya Nand
04/05/2026
Photo: Getty Images

Manchester United secured a thrilling 3-2 win over Liverpool at Old Trafford to move up to fourth place in the Premier League.

United led 2-nil at half-time thanks to goals from Matheus Cunha and Benjamin Sesko.

Liverpool fought back quickly after the break, with goals from Dominik Szoboszlai and Cody Gakpo to make it 2-all.

The winner came late when Kobbie Mainoo scored in the 77th minute.

Mainoo’s goal came just days after signing a new five-year contract.

The win secures United’s return to the Champions League, while Liverpool still need points to qualify.

In other matches, AFC Bournemouth beat Crystal Palace 3-nil, while Tottenham Hotspur will face Aston Villa at 7am.

Meanwhile, Arsenal leads the table with 76 points, Manchester City is second with 70 points, while Manchester United is third with 64 points.
